What Are Vacuum Bots?
Vacuum bots are automated cleaning devices that use innovative sensors, algorithms, and motors to browse and tidy floorings. They are usually disc-shaped and variety in size from a few inches to a foot in diameter. These robots are geared up with numerous features such as laser navigation, camera-based mapping, and challenge detection, enabling them to efficiently tidy different kinds of surface areas, consisting of wood, carpet, and tile.
How Do Vacuum Bots Work?
Navigation and Mapping:
Laser Navigation: Some vacuum bots use L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) technology to produce an in-depth map of the room. This allows them to browse around obstacles and tidy effectively.Camera-Based Navigation: Others use electronic cameras and computer system vision to determine things and plan their cleaning path.Virtual Walls and robotvacuummops.uk No-Go Zones: These features allow users to set boundaries where the robot should not enter, making sure that certain areas remain unblemished.
Cleaning Mechanisms:
Brushes and Suction: Vacuum bots are equipped with side brushes to sweep particles towards the center and primary brushes to get dirt and dust. They likewise have effective suction capabilities to remove ingrained dirt.HEPA Filters: Many designs include HEPA filters to trap irritants and improve air quality.Mopping Attachments: Some advanced designs included mopping attachments to deal with damp cleaning jobs.
Connectivity and Control:

Q: How often should I clean my vacuum bot?
A: It is advised to clear the dustbin and tidy the brushes after each use. The HEPA filter should be cleaned or replaced every couple of months, depending upon usage.
Q: Can vacuum bots clean stairs?
A: Most vacuum bots are not designed to tidy stairs. Nevertheless, some designs can browse small steps or thresholds, but they must not be utilized on stairs for security and efficiency reasons.
Q: Are vacuum bots appropriate for homes with family pets?
A: Yes, numerous vacuum bots are specifically developed to handle pet hair and dander. Try to find models with strong suction and efficient brush systems to guarantee ideal performance in homes with pets.
Q: Can vacuum bots replace traditional vacuums?
A: While vacuum bots can deal with daily cleaning jobs efficiently, they are not a total replacement for standard vacuums. For deep cleaning and bigger messes, a conventional vacuum is still essential.
Q: How do I set up a vacuum bot?
A: Setting up a vacuum bot is uncomplicated. A lot of models come with a user manual that guides you through the procedure, which usually includes charging the robot, connecting it to Wi-Fi, and establishing a cleaning schedule through a mobile app.
